Bulls Say, Bears Say

Bulls Say
Presales-driven Cash InflowsGafisa’s core business collects down payments and installments during construction, a structural cash-inflow model that reduces funding needs for projects. Over 2–6 months this supports working capital, lowers immediate refinancing pressure and aligns cash receipts with construction milestones.
Improved LeverageA lower debt-to-equity ratio versus prior periods materially reduces solvency and refinancing risk. This improved leverage position gives management greater flexibility to fund new projects or withstand slower sales cycles without immediately needing dilutive capital or expensive short-term borrowing.
Prior Proven ProfitabilityHistorical profitability in 2021 indicates the business model can generate positive returns under better market conditions. This suggests project economics and operations can be viable if sales velocity, pricing or cost controls recover, supporting a potential durable turnaround if structural drivers improve.
Bears Say
Shrinking RevenueA sustained top-line decline reduces margin absorption and undermines fixed-cost leverage across developments. Continued revenue contraction can delay unit launches, impair land monetization and force reliance on external financing, weakening the company’s ability to restore scale and profitability.
Deep Negative MarginsVery large net losses indicate projects or operations are currently value-destructive. Persistently negative margins erode equity, constrain reinvestment, and make it harder to attract credit or strategic partners, creating a multi-month structural headwind to recovery absent meaningful cost or pricing fixes.
Negative Operating And Free Cash FlowOngoing negative operating and free cash flow forces dependence on external financing or working-capital swings to fund construction and closings. Over a 2–6 month horizon this raises refinancing and execution risk, potentially delaying deliveries and worsening project economics if liquidity options tighten.

                    Company Description

                    Gafisa SA

                    Gafisa S.A. is a leading Brazilian real estate firm that specializes in home construction, operating under its proprietary Gafisa brand. The company is involved in the entire process of property development, sales, and brokerage. Its offerings include a diverse portfolio of residential properties: luxury buildings, replete with premium amenities such as swimming pools, gyms, and visitor parking, which cater to affluent and mid-income customers; and more affordable apartment complexes and houses designed for lower-middle-income segments. Gafisa also develops and sells commercial units. Beyond direct property sales, Gafisa expands its activities by developing land parcels for future sale. Additionally, it offers construction, technical consultancy, and real estate management services to third-party clients. Gafisa S.A. was founded in 1954 and is headquartered in São Paulo, Brazil.
